More Than Just Oil Changes: The Science of Modern Car Systems
When people consider car maintenance, they normally picture an oil change or perhaps examining tire pressure. While those are very important, they just scratch the surface. Automobiles today are crafted with innovative systems that communicate with each other in real-time. From sensors that track temperature and pressure to software application that readjusts engine efficiency on the fly, your lorry is more intelligent than you might believe.
The engine, for instance, is a marvel of combustion science. Gasoline mixes with air, compresses in the cylinder, and fires up to push pistons that turn your wheels. This process occurs countless times per minute and requires precise timing, optimal fuel-to-air proportions, and a cooling system that prevents getting too hot. Normal upkeep makes sure that all these moving parts continue to be in sync, protecting against unneeded wear and maximizing efficiency.
Comprehending the Heartbeat of Your Vehicle: Diagnostics and Data
One of the most underrated facets of auto upkeep is diagnostics. Your automobile's onboard computer accumulates data continuously, keeping track of every feature from exhausts to engine tons. When that check engine light pops on, it's not simply a generic warning-- maybe indicating a wide variety of problems varying from a loose gas cap to something more severe like a failing oxygen sensing unit.
Service technicians use analysis tools to accessibility this data, converting the information right into workable repair work. It's like running a wellness scan on your auto. Without this insight, auto mechanics would certainly be left guessing, and your automobile might suffer even more damage over time. That's why normal evaluations and check-ups are so vital.
Maintaining Things Rolling: The Unsung Heroes of Car Maintenance
Not all upkeep takes place under the hood. In fact, a few of one of the most critical aspects of keeping your automobile secure and efficient are found underneath and around it. Take your wheels, for instance. Having appropriate wheel alignment service not only extends the life of your tires however additionally guarantees much better gas performance and a smoother ride.
When wheels are misaligned, your cars and truck could pull to one side or the other. It can likewise place irregular stress on your tires, causing them to wear out quicker. Even worse, it can impact exactly how your automobile takes care of in emergency situations. Getting a wheel alignment service might not seem like a big deal, but it's an important step in keeping your automobile secure when traveling.

It's All Connected: The Interplay of Systems
What makes cars and truck upkeep genuinely fascinating is just how interconnected whatever is. A worn-out air filter can lead to minimized fuel performance. Low tire stress can set off warning lights and shake off your vehicle's equilibrium. Even something as relatively easy as old ignition system can affect just how smoothly your cars and truck starts in the early morning.
That's the hidden science behind all of it: the little things matter. The consistency between electrical systems, mechanical components, and digital diagnostics is what makes contemporary cars so effective-- therefore sensitive to forget. Disregarding one concern can create a domino effect, causing larger, more costly troubles down the line.
